Gregory Mankiw, 9th edition, is a foundational text in the field of macroeconomic studies, providing a comprehensive overview of critical economic theories and practices. The book is expertly structured, starting with core concepts such as GDP, unemployment, and inflation, and advancing into more complex discussions of fiscal policy, monetary policy, and international economics. The edition presents a clear 'solution manual' that highlights practical applications of macroeconomic models, making it an invaluable resource for students seeking to understand the implications of economic decisions on a large scale. Key themes include the analysis of economic growth, the role of government in economic regulation, and the dynamics of the global economy.
